Responsibilities Tasks
  • Develop production schedules and duty assignments to ensure proper functioning
  • Evaluate daily operations
  • Maintain an inventory of raw materials and finished products to prevent shortages
  • Plan and organize daily operations
  • Read blueprints and drawings
  • Direct quality control inspections
  • Hire, supervise and train or oversee training of employees in the use of new equipment or production techniques
  • Organize and maintain inventory
  • Plan and implement changes to machinery and equipment, production systems and methods of work
  • Plan and manage the establishment of departmental budget
